We concluded our journey along the Biscayne Coast with a stop at this beach. It's a great spot, particularly if you are travelling with young children. At low tide, the beach is expansive with various spots to take a dip. The ocean side is sheltered, with barely any waves, and the water is shallow enough to wade through even after walking a considerable distance. There is plenty of parking available, along with a few eateries. You can rent kayaks and paddle boards, but sadly, not umbrellas or chairs.
